Transaction 1278cc37bfa1ce691cbd5c3205eeb66d091dab3a3c731bb7046944d58e4a8865
4 Input
1 Outputs
- 1278cc37bfa1ce691cbd5c3205eeb66d091dab3a3c731bb7046944d58e4a8865:0
value 7146003
address 38V1S1Ncu18ZXdtThQHvxZC24TY2nD14BD